- Abstract
- This paper describes the concept and implementation details of the synchronization mechanisms used in the control and data-acquisitionsystem of the RFX (Reversed-Field Experiment) nuclear-fusion experimental device, at present under construction in Padova, Italy, within the framework of the co-ordinated nuclear-fusion research programme of the European Communities. The system employs industrial PLCs for the \"slow\" control and monitoring functions, and aVAX-based CAMAC for the \"fast\" functions of trigger-signal generation and dataacquisition during the experiment pulses. All subsystems communicative via Ethernet, using compatible software protocols. The operational sequence of the complete system is governed by a single state machine implemented on aPLC-based supervisor system. Equivalent \"slave\" state machines are implemented on all other subsystems (PLC-and VAX-based). These state machines are synchronized by means of the exchange of messages via Ethernet. This paper deals in detail with the following components which are involved in systemsynchronization:
- the Message Exchange System which implements the system-wide exchange of short messages;
- the Scheduler programs which implement the state machine on the various computing nodes, and which make use of the Message Exchange System. (literal)
